What this means for your family

While the physical therapy department is frequently praised for its effectiveness, the facility has a recurring pattern of severe neglect and understaffing. Families should be extremely cautious and are advised to conduct unannounced visits, specifically checking on call-bell response times and the cleanliness of the patient's room before committing.

Alaris Health at Hamilton Park receives highly polarized reviews, with many families reporting severe neglect, poor hygiene, and significant understaffing. While some patients praise the physical and occupational therapy departments for successful rehabilitation, others describe a facility plagued by slow response times, missing personal belongings, and unprofessional communication from staff.

This facility shows concerning patterns with recurring problems in resident assessment, fire safety, and infection control across multiple years. Families have filed complaints that led to findings of deficient wound care, incontinence management, and failure to properly report suspected abuse. While the facility corrects issues when cited, the same problems repeatedly resurface - particularly inadequate resident assessments and infection prevention - suggesting systemic challenges that may impact care quality.
